Action item from the Fernwick outage: the orders table purge job treated soft-deleted rows as gone and skipped them during reconciliation, so refunds double-fired. Fix: purge must respect the tombstone window and run only inside the quiet period. On-call owns verifying the new sweep against staging before Friday. The sweep behavior is controlled by these constants.

tuning table, faduf-baduf:
PRIORITIES = {
    "ulavan": 191,
    "silys": 750,
    "goriel": 238,
    "kelmir": 66,
    "wendor": 432,
}

Welcome to the Giftleaf support rotation!

The donation-receipt mailer sends a PDF receipt within a few minutes of every donation clearing. If a donor says they never got one, first check the Sendloom dashboard — nine times out of ten it's a bounced address. You can re-trigger a receipt from the admin panel, but your local tooling needs to authenticate against the mailer API first. Pop this line into your .env and you're set.

vault entry, yahif-yajep: COURIER_KEY29=b802bdf8034096b65a51c6ba5abe2

Subject: DR Drill — Monthly Partition Failover

Dear plugin authors: during next week's drill, Quorvia will fail over the ledger tables, which are partitioned by calendar month. Your plugins should tolerate brief read-only windows on the current partition. Please verify retry logic beforehand. To access the drill sandbox's restored snapshot, you will need the recovery passphrase provided just below.

vault phrase of tajeg-tageg = pelix-druix-holius-briael-zorwyn-frawyn-fraox-norok-drueth-aldiel

14:22 — Canary gate for Thornquist Checkout held at 5% because error-rate rule compared against a stale baseline from the overnight batch window. Gate never promoted; on-call assumed a rollout freeze. Support fielded slow-checkout tickets for 40 minutes before correlation. Action: baselines now recomputed hourly; gate rules log the comparison window. If a customer references this incident, confirm their requests hit the canary by matching the token below.

session token of kafof-kafop = htk31_c3becf8b8eac3ed970037fba36e258e